What is the Florida Annual
The Florida Annual is a crucial document that businesses in Florida are required to file annually. This form provides essential information about a company's activities, financial status, and compliance with state regulations. It serves to keep the state informed about the business's operations and ensures that all entities adhere to the legal standards set forth by Florida law. Understanding the purpose and requirements of the Florida Annual is vital for maintaining good standing with state authorities.

Filing Deadlines / Important Dates
Timely filing of the Florida Annual is critical to avoid penalties. The deadlines may vary based on the business entity type. Generally, most businesses are required to file their annual report by May first each year. It is advisable to check the specific deadlines for your entity type to ensure compliance. Missing the deadline can lead to late fees and potential administrative dissolution of the business.
Required Documents
To complete the Florida Annual, certain documents and information are typically required. These may include:
- Business identification number or employer identification number (EIN).
- Legal name and address of the business.
- Details regarding the business structure, such as LLC, corporation, or partnership.
- Information about the principal officers or members of the business.
Having these documents ready will facilitate a smoother filing process.
Who Issues the Form
The Florida Annual is issued by the Florida Department of State, Division of Corporations. This agency is responsible for maintaining the official records of businesses operating within the state. They provide the necessary forms and guidelines for completing the Florida Annual, ensuring that all businesses comply with state regulations.
Penalties for Non-Compliance
Failure to file the Florida Annual can result in significant penalties. Businesses that miss the filing deadline may incur late fees, which can accumulate over time. Additionally, non-compliance may lead to administrative dissolution, meaning the state can revoke the business's legal status. It is essential for business owners to prioritize the timely submission of this form to avoid these consequences.
